István Jankovics is a scholar working on Epidemiology, Infectious Diseases and Agronomy and Crop Science. According to data from OpenAlex, István Jankovics has authored 22 papers receiving a total of 362 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Epidemiology, 7 papers in Infectious Diseases and 4 papers in Agronomy and Crop Science. Recurrent topics in István Jankovics's work include Influenza Virus Research Studies (11 papers), Respiratory viral infections research (8 papers) and SARS-CoV-2 and COVID-19 Research (5 papers). István Jankovics is often cited by papers focused on Influenza Virus Research Studies (11 papers), Respiratory viral infections research (8 papers) and SARS-CoV-2 and COVID-19 Research (5 papers). István Jankovics collaborates with scholars based in Hungary, United Kingdom and Ukraine. István Jankovics's co-authors include Zoltán Vajó, Ferenc D. Tamás, Judit Cervenak, Imre Gerlinger, Anikó Nagy, Attila G. Végh, Imre Kacskovıcs, Gábor Katona, Zsófia Mészner and György Reusz and has published in prestigious journals such as The Lancet, Journal of Virology and Frontiers in Immunology.
